Uncover Your Partner's Love Language
In the intricate tapestry of relationships, understanding your partner's love language can reveal a world of deeper connection. Love languages, popularized by Dr. Gary Chapman, are the ways in which individuals receive and understand love. By recognizing your significant other's primary love language, you can demonstrate in a way that truly resonates with them, strengthening your bond.
- copyright of affirmation are for those who thrive on verbal expressions of love, such as compliments, encouragement, and kind copyright.
- Gestures of service speak to individuals who feel most loved through tangible acts of help and support.
- Receiving gifts is a love language for those who appreciate thoughtful presents that express your love and care.
- Quality time signifies the importance of undivided attention and shared experiences for individuals with this love language.
- Physical touch is a love language for those who feel comforted by physical closeness, such as hugs, kisses, and holding hands.
Learning your partner's love language can be a truly transformative journey in your relationship. By understanding their needs and showing affection in ways that resonate with them, you can foster a deeper sense of love and create a lasting bond built on mutual understanding and appreciation.

Building a Strong Foundation: Communication Tips for Couples
Open and honest communication is the bedrock of any healthy relationship. When you nurture a space where both partners feel comfortable sharing their thoughts and feelings, it deepens the emotional bond. Active listening is crucial; truly hear to what your partner is saying, not just waiting for your turn to speak. Validate their emotions, even if you don't always agree.
A clear way of communicating your own needs and feelings can minimize misunderstandings. Use "I" statements instead of blaming or critical language. For example, instead of saying "You always make me feel neglectful", try "I feel unimportant when..."
Periodically checking in with each other can help keep communication flowing smoothly. Make time for dedicated conversations where you can both discuss your day, feelings, and aspirations.
